\( \sqrt{53} \) का स्थान किन दो पूर्णांकों के बीच होगा?

Between which two integers will \( \sqrt{53} \) lie?

Author: Muft Shiksha Editorial Team Published:
Explanation opens after your attempt
Correct Answer

C. (7) और (8)(7) and (8)

Step 1

Concept

\(7^2=49\) and \(8^2=64\), so \( \sqrt{53} \) lies between (7) and (8). Check limits by squaring.
